Excerpts from Rainer Orth's message of Juni 13, 2022 8:58 pm:
> Hi Iain,
> 
>> This patches merges the D front-end with upstream dmd 821ed393d, and the
>> standard library with upstream druntime 454471d8 and phobos 1206fc94f.
> 
>> libphobos/ChangeLog:
>>
>> 	* libdruntime/MERGE: Merge upstream druntime 454471d8.
>> 	* libdruntime/Makefile.am (DRUNTIME_DSOURCES): Add
>> 	core/sync/package.d.
>> 	* libdruntime/Makefile.in: Regenerate.
>> 	* src/MERGE: Merge upstream phobos 1206fc94f.
> 
> unfortunately, you missed core/sync/package.d here, breaking the build:
> 
> make[5]: *** No rule to make target 'core/sync/package.d', needed by 'core/sync/package.lo'.  Stop.
> 

Hi Rainer,

Really sorry for that, I've checked the core.sync package module in
r13-1077.

Iain.

---
 libphobos/libdruntime/core/sync/package.d | 20 ++++++++++++++++++++
 1 file changed, 20 insertions(+)

diff --git a/libphobos/libdruntime/core/sync/package.d b/libphobos/libdruntime/core/sync/package.d
new file mode 100644
index 00000000000..fe389a0475d
--- /dev/null
+++ b/libphobos/libdruntime/core/sync/package.d
@@ -0,0 +1,20 @@
+/**
+ * Provides thread synchronization tools such as mutexes, semaphores and barriers.
+ *
+ * License: Distributed under the
+ *      $(LINK2 http://www.boost.org/LICENSE_1_0.txt, Boost Software License 1.0).
+ *    (See accompanying file LICENSE)
+ * Authors:   Sean Kelly, Rainer Schuetze
+ * Source:    $(DRUNTIMESRC core/sync/package.d)
+ */
+
+module core.sync;
+
+public import core.sync.barrier;
+public import core.sync.condition;
+public import core.sync.config;
+public import core.sync.event;
+public import core.sync.exception;
+public import core.sync.mutex;
+public import core.sync.rwmutex;
+public import core.sync.semaphore;
